Texas 2013 - 83rd Regular

Texas Senate Bill SR922

Caption

Recognizing Thea Ulrich-Lewis for her participation in the Texas Legislative Internship Program.

Summary

Senate Resolution No. 922 recognizes Thea Ulrich-Lewis for her exemplary participation in the Texas Legislative Internship Program. This program offers students from Texas colleges and universities a unique opportunity to engage directly in governmental processes through internships in various legislative bodies and agencies. The resolution highlights Thea's contributions during her internship in Senator José Rodríguez's office, underscoring the critical connection between education and practical experience in the field of public policy.
